The resort is remarkable to relax with children: a good ecological situation, picturesque nature, the sea is not deep, a wide sandy beach strip with rare islets of shallow pebbles. Unlike many "bulk" beaches of Alanya and other spa places in Turkey, where sand is brought, natural sandy beaches spread to Many tens of kilometers.

Didim will be a good place to stay in July and August, when tourists are tangled in Antalya from the heat, on the Aegean coast a little cool, so much more comfortable - sea water temperature is 22-24 degrees, which is very refreshing. The resort is in the stage of its formation and development, so the choice of hotels is small (not compare with the manifold of Marmaris, Side, Belek). But there is a positive moment in this - not everything is subordinate to tourism, natural natural beauty has been preserved. Didim is assigned a European blue flag - a sign of distinguishing the best beaches and a purest sea water.

Of the minuses should be noted distance from airports. The arrival may be in Dalaman, Izmir or Bodrum, the distance from any of them will be from 100 to 150 km. Transfer from the airport to Didima is tedious.
